Sultana Population - Hazaribagh, Jharkhand

Sultana is a large village located in Katamdag Block of Hazaribagh district, Jharkhand with total 656 families residing. The Sultana village has population of 4083 of which 2089 are males while 1994 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sultana village population of children with age 0-6 is 668 which makes up 16.36 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sultana village is 955 which is higher than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Sultana as per census is 994,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.

Sultana village has higher liter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Sultana village was 70.34 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Sultana Male literacy stands at 78.73 % while female literacy rate was 61.47 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 7.54 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.07 % of total population in Sultana village.

Work Profile

In Sultana village out of total population, 1154 were engaged in work activities. 70.97 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 29.03 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1154 workers engaged in Main Work, 61 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 25 were Agricultural labourer.
